What are the main types of travel booking engines?

A
Travel booking engines are essential tools in the travel industry, enabling users to search, compare, and book travel services such as flights, hotels, and car rentals. There are several main types of travel booking engines, each serving different purposes and target audiences.

. Corporate Booking Engines: These are designed for businesses to manage and streamline their corporate travel arrangements. Corporate booking engines often include features such as policy compliance, expense tracking, and integration with travel management systems. They help companies control travel costs and ensure that employees adhere to company travel policies.

. Online Travel Agency (OTA) Booking Engines: OTAs use booking engines to provide a comprehensive platform for consumers to book travel services. These engines aggregate content from multiple suppliers and offer users the ability to search and compare options in real time. Examples include Expedia and Booking.com.

. Supplier Direct Booking Engines: These engines are operated directly by travel service providers such as airlines, hotel chains, and car rental companies. They allow customers to book directly with the supplier, often offering exclusive deals and promotions. Supplier direct booking engines are typically integrated with the provider’s own reservation systems.

. Metasearch Engines: Metasearch engines aggregate search results from multiple booking engines and travel websites. They compare prices and availability from various sources to provide users with a comprehensive view of travel options. Examples include Kayak and Skyscanner.

. Custom Booking Engines: These are tailored solutions designed for specific needs or niche markets. Custom booking engines may be developed for unique travel services or specialized markets, offering customized features and functionalities based on the requirements of the business.

In summary, the main types of travel booking engines include corporate booking engines, OTA booking engines, supplier direct booking engines, metasearch engines, and custom booking engines. Each type serves different needs and provides varying features to enhance the travel booking experience.
